Dative Au→Al interactions: crystallographic characterization and computational analysis.

Marc Devillard1, Emmanuel Nicolas, Andreas W Ehlers, Jana Backs, Sonia Mallet-Ladeira, Ghenwa Bouhadir, J Chris Slootweg, Werner Uhl, Didier Bourissou.   

Abstract

Hitherto unknown Au→Al interactions have been evidenced upon coordination of the geminal phosphorus-aluminum Lewis pair Mes2 PC(=CHPh)AltBu2 (Mes=2,4,6-trimethylphenyl). Four different gold(I) complexes featuring alkyl (Me), aryl (Ph, C6F5), and alkynyl (C≡CPh) co-ligands have been prepared. X-ray diffraction analyses show that P→Au→Al bridging coordination induces noticeable bending of the ligand (the PCAl bond angle shrinks by 13°). This new type of transition metal→Lewis acid interaction has been analyzed by DFT calculations.
